A valid conclusion from the graph is; a difference in the pH of an environment changes enzyme activity.
An enzyme is a biological catalyst that promotes biochemical reactions in the body. Enzymes are specific in their actions. Enzymes act on particular substrates. There is an optimum pH of enzyme activity. The pH of an environment affects enzyme activity.
According to the graph shown, the activity of the enzyme is plotted against the pH of the environment. we can see from the graph that a difference in the pH of an environment changes enzyme activity.
